Background technology
Mixing plant generally has, propeller mixer, is made of 2~3 pusher propeller leaves, and working speed is higher,
The peripheral speed of blade outer rim is generally 5~15m/s, and dasher has two kinds of flat paddle formula and oblique paddle.Flat-blade paddle agitator
It is made of the straight blade of two panels.The ratio between diameter of propeller blade and height is 4~10, and peripheral speed is 1.5~3m/s, generated radial direction
Flow stream velocity is smaller.Two leaves of inclined paddle type agitator are turned back 45 ° or 60 ° on the contrary, thus generate axial liquid stream., anchor agitator,
Blade outer rim shape and tank diameter inner wall will unanimously, and only very little gap, can remove the adhesive reaction production being attached on cell wall therebetween
Object or the solids for being piled up in slot bottom, keep preferable heat-transfer effect.
